2016년 5월 24일 아래 SDK가 출시되었으므로, 출시 이력을 공유합니다.
대상 SDK:안드로이드NDK SDK、iOS SDK、Marmalade SDK、Windows SDK、 Emscripten SDK、Linux SDK、Mac OS X SDK、tvOS SDK、WindowsStore SDK
버전:4.1.3.0
■chat-cpp
없음
■chat-objc
없음
■common-cpp
Date: 05-24-2016
-추가:Marmalade Universal Windows Platform용 서포트
-변경:메모리 관리는 모두 스레드 세이프(thread-safe)가 되었습니다
-수정:키 타입 오브젝트용DictionaryBase::getKeys() 서포트
■common-objc
없음
■loadBalancing-cpp
Date: 05-24-2016
-변경:Peer;opWebRpc()및 Client(opWebRpc()는 Photon시리얼라이제이션에서 서포트되는 파라미터 'parameters'용의 모든 타입의 데이터를 직접 수용하게 되었습니다. 발신자는 Common;Object 인스턴스 내의 페이로드를 가장 먼저 랩 할 필요가 없어졌습니다.
-변경:Peer;opWebRpc()와 Client(opWebRpc()의 파라미터'parameters'가 옵션이 되었습니다
-추가:enum RegionSelectionMode
-추가:Client::getRegionWithBestPing()
-변경:클래스 클라이언트의 컨스트럭터의 불(boolean) 파라미터'useDefaultRegion'을 nByte 파라미터'regionSelectionMode'로 치환했습니다
-변경:ErrorCode::GAME_DOES_NOT_EXISTS를 GAME_DOES_NOT_EXIST로 명칭을 변경했습니다
■loadBalancing-objc
Date: 05-24-2016
-변경:EGLoadBalancingPeer::opWebRpc()와 EGLoadBalancingClient::opWebRpc()의 파라미터'parameters'가 옵션이 되었습니다
-변경:같은 이름이 지어진 opRaiseEvent()의 파라미터 타입 서포트에 부합하도록 EGLoadBalancingPeer::opWebRpc()과 EGLoadBalancingClient::opWebRpc()의 파라미터'parameters'를 const NSObject*에서 id<NSObject>로 변경했습니다.
-추가:enum EGRegionSelectionMode
-추가:EGLoadBalancingClient.RegionWithBestPing
-변경:클래스 클라이언트의 컨스트럭터의 불(boolean) 파라미터'useDefaultRegion'을 nByte 파라미터'regionSelectionMode'로 치환했습니다
■photon-cpp
Date: 05-20-2016
- 추가: PhotonPeer::pingServer()
- 추가: PhotonListener::onPingResponse()
■photon-objc
Date: 05-24-2016
- 추가: EGPhotonPeer::pingServer()
- 추가: EGPhotonListener::onPingResponse()
- 삭제:그동안 실제로는 사용되지 않았던 EGEventCode_DISCONNECT를 삭제했습니다
- 추가: EGConnectionProtocol_DEFAULT
또한, 영문의 변경 이력(신규/과거)에 대해서는 SDK 안의 원문을 확인해주세요.
댓글
댓글 0개
댓글을 남기려면 로그인하세요.